The Air Force 1: This Enduring Style
Few kicks have enjoyed the cultural recognition and lasting appeal of the Air Force 1. First released in 1982, this performance trainer quickly transcended its intended purpose, becoming a beloved symbol of streetwear style. Its minimalist design, supportive construction, and exceptional versatility have ensured its persistent status across generations. Despite its sporting beginnings, the Air Force 1 remains a symbol to classic design and a cornerstone in any fashion landscape.

The Nike Air Force
The legendary Nike Air Force series stands as a testament to years relentless advancement and cultural influence. Initially released in 1982, the Air Force 1 – or AF1 as it's affectionately called – wasn't just a basketball shoe; it was a revolutionary statement. Employing advanced Nike Air technology, particularly the visible Air unit, it offered exceptional comfort and cushioning for players on the hardwood. But its lasting legacy lies in its shift from the basketball arena to a global cultural phenomenon. This remarkable journey cemented its place as a enduring icon in the history of footwear.
